World Shipping Council Statement on World Ocean Day 2025 Washington/London/Brussels/Singapore, June 8, 2025 — On this World Ocean Day, we celebrate the immense value of the Ocean – a source of life, food, energy, and biodiversity, and a vital ally in the fight against global warming. The Ocean produces half of the world’s oxygen, and as the world’s largest carbon sink, absorbs a quarter of all CO₂ emissions. It sustains communities, supports eco…
